FORT Robotics enhances the safety and security of autonomous machines and robots using advanced wireless technology. They provide reliable wireless solutions, with their main product being the Wireless E-Stop, which allows operators to remotely stop machines in emergencies, preventing accidents and reducing downtime. FORT Robotics serves various sectors, including transportation, agriculture, and manufacturing, and differentiates itself by focusing on safety solutions that integrate into existing machinery. Their goal is to maximize productivity for clients while minimizing risks, generating revenue through hardware sales, software updates, and support services.
